Using geotechnical engineering in pipeline design, construction. Part 2

To analyze the restraining force of soil at pipe bends and the usage of anchors and thrust blocks to counter this force, researchers used finite-element modeling techniques employing basic stress-strain parameters of the soil backfill, Although the actual radial force varies along the length of the bend in a three-dimensional manner, a two-dimensional analysis on a 1-ft-long section of the bend subjected to maximum radial force per foot proved satisfactory for this study.
